Does Wharton take a third of the analyst spots
So there’s approximately 1000 analyst positions in top boutique/ BB across the US. If Wharton has 500 students a class and say 350 of those go into analyst positions, are they really taking a third of those positions? That’s crazy
Wharton kid here - we do not take up 1/3 of the analyst positions. Believe it or not, not all Wharton kids go to the top boutiques and BBs....

How are you making these assumptions? Of the 500, the majority go into IB, but not all. They also go straight to buy-side, consulting, or something else in the business world. Even if there are 350 going into IB, they don't all end up at an EB/BB. Some end up at MM firms, regional boutiques, global non-BB banks, etc.
